Ace Cricketer Mohammad Yousuf Stuck Due To Visa Problems
Pakistani cricketer Mohammad Yousuf, who is part of the team Lahore Lions is a happy man, even though he could not be part of the 15 member Pakistan team which is going to Toronto to play the quadrangular Twenty20 tournament, due to delay in getting visa from the Canadian High Commission.
He said, "I am happy that finally the selectors did consider me for this brand of the game". Yousuf had been kept out of the team for the Twenty20 format by the selectors but later taken in when he aired his annoyance.
The cricketer said "I just want to know what the selection procedure is....You go and ask great players like Wasim Akram and Inzamam-ul-Haq if I don't deserve to play Twenty20 cricket. If they say I should be dropped then I will quit all cricket
Commenting on the Twenty20 game he said "I think what is apparent is that now even Twenty20 cricket is becoming a form of the game where you have to play sensible cricket”.
He is now gearing up to play domestic cricket .His team Lahore Lions lost in the semi-final of the RBS twenty20 Cup to the defending champions Sialkot Stallions.
